如果该属性的值为 TRXUNDO ACTIVE,则意味着有一个活跃的事务正在向这个 Undo 页面链表中写入 undo 日志,然后再在 Undo Segment Header 中找到 TRX UNDO LAST LOG 属性,通过该属性可以找到本Undo 页面链表最后一个 ...
如果该属性的值为 TRXUNDO ACTIVE,则意味着有一个活跃的事务正在向这个 Undo 页面链表中写入 undo 日志,然后再在 Undo Segment Header 中找到 TRX UNDO LAST LOG 属性,通过该属性可以找到本Undo 页面链表最后一个 ...
对于oracle的回滚段的分配与管理,实际上不那么复杂,当然如果我们从原理甚至从oracle internal的角度深究相关问题的话有不是一件容易的事。但对于我们普通开发人员和DBA来说,重要的是在概念上清晰,原理上了解,...
正在看的ORACLE教程是:Oracle回滚段的概念,用法和规划及问题的解决。回滚段管理一直是ORACLE数据库管理的一个难题,本文通过实例介绍ORACLE回滚段的概念,用法和规划及问题的解决。 回滚段概述 回滚段用于存放...
一、回滚段变更 二、什么是回滚段 Mysql5.5之前的版本,只能用到1024个并发线程。 Mysql5.5版本,能用到1024*128个并发线程,约12w并发线程;存放在共享表空间(ibdata) Mysql5.6版本,把回滚段放到...
Oracle 回滚段管理1、ora-01555错误的是怎么产生的?有什么办法解决?2、回滚段(回滚表空间)有什么作用?3、数据库启动的时候,如何加载回滚段(回滚段表空间)。4、回滚段的数量由什么公式来计算5、回滚表空间的大小...
回滚段空间不够ORA-01562 - failed to extend rollback segment number string回滚段空间不够的原因一般有以下几种情况:A. 回滚段所在表空间剩余的空闲空间太小, 无法分配下一个EXTENT.B. 回滚段扩展次数已经达到...
ORACLE回滚段回滚段概述回滚段用于存放数据修改之前的值(包括数据修改之前的位置和值)。回滚段的头部包含正在使用的该回滚段事务的信息。一个事务只能使用一个回滚段来存放它的回滚信息,而一个回滚段可以存放多个...
###############################################################################undo与回滚段edit by sky on 20111125reference biti、Kirtikumar Deshpande不涉及RBU qq654268465#############################...
1.1回滚段的基本概念(1)回滚段概述回滚段用于存放数据修改之前的值(包括数据修改之前的位置和值)。回滚段的头部包含正在使用的该回滚段事务的信息。一个事务只能使用一个回滚段来存放它的回滚信息,而一个回滚段可以...
--查询数据文件select t.TABLESPACE_NAME, --表空间名t.FILE_NAME, --文件名t.AUTOEXTENSIBLE, --是否自动扩展t.BYTES / 1024 / 1024 as tsize, --表空间初始大小t.MAXBYTES / 1024 / 1024 msize, --表空间最大扩展...
Oracle数据库回滚段的故障分析与性能优化.pdf
Oracle回滚段管理回滚段管理一直是ORACLE数据库管理的一个难题,本文通过实例介绍ORACLE回滚段的概念回滚段概述回滚段用于存放数据修改之前的值(包括数据修改之前的位置和值)。回滚段的头部包含正在使用的该回滚段...
tid=476549好像不起作用了。SQL> col name for a12SQL> select s.usn,n.name,s.extents,s.optsize,s.hwmsize,s.status from v$rollstat s, v$rollname n where s.u...
想了解Oracle回滚段使用查询代码详解的相关内容吗,暁樱在本文为您仔细讲解oracle 回滚段使用查询的相关知识和一些Code实例,欢迎阅读和指正,我们先划重点:oracle,回滚段使用查询,oracle,回滚段,下面大家一起来...
Oracle回滚段的概念,用法和规划及问题的解决回滚段管理一直是ORACLE数据库管理的一个难题,本文通过实例介绍ORACLE回滚段的概念,用法和规划及问题的解决。回滚段概述回滚段用于存放数据修改之前的值(包括数据修改...
UNDO/ROLLBACK表空间是用于存放回滚段(Rollback Segment)的表空间。回滚段是Oracle用于保存被修改的数据的前映象的数据空间。每个回滚段包含一些扩展(EXTENTS),回滚段采用一种循环机制来...
标签: oracle
1.常用事务操作 ...1)A:原子性—事务是原子级的、不可分割的有机体,这意味着,事务过程修改是不能分割的,即过程修改或者全部执行成功,或者全部执行失败回滚,不能存在部分成功部分失败的场景;...
在很多情况下,数据库是启着... B) 另一个方法是 offline 掉所有的那个文件所属表空间的回滚段, drop 那个表空间 , 然后得建它们。你可能不得不杀掉那些使用着回滚段的进程,以便使它 offline。 方法 II。A: 从备份...
两张表,表结构如下:-- Create tablecreate table ZL_ZBB(ZBIDVARCHAR2(30) not null,ZBTMVARCHAR2(30) not null,YJZLVARCHAR2(3) not null,CZRQCHAR(1) not null,YJJDM VARCHAR2(8) not null,JDJDM VARCHAR2(8) ...
1. 概述本文主要从回滚段的原理,分配和使用,以及回滚段的相关参数包括初始化参数的设置和回滚段的管理来介绍回滚段。以及回滚段涉及的多种问题。2. 回滚段工作原理回滚段是磁盘上的一段存储空间,用来保存数据变化...
大批量执行DML语句造成回滚段大量占用,又回退操作,如何直观查询数据回滚情况? 单机环境 查询回滚执行进度 select /*+ rule */s.sid, r.name rr, nvl(s.username,'no transaction') us, s.osuser os, s.terminal...
查看回滚段名称及大小COLUMN roll_name FORMAT a13 HEADING 'Rollback Name'COLUMN tablespaceFORMAT a11 HEADING 'Tablspace'COLUMN in_extentsFORMAT a20 HEADING 'Init/Next Extents'COLU...
1.监控PGA的视图:v$sql_workarea_active、v$sql_workarea、v$sesstat、v$process、v$sysstat、v$sql_workarea_histogram等。2.使用下面的视图查看Oracle建议的评估设置:Select pga_target_for_estimate/1024/1024 |...
2. 如果Oracle temp已满,则会出现两种情况:a.ora-1652无法将temp段扩展256个表空间错误,事务将回滚。b、 Oracle会提前重用temp空间,这可能会影响flashback操作。oracletemp表空间满了,怎么办?当...
1、查询回滚段信息:状态为ONLINE,当前UNDO表空间为undotbs1SQL>select segment_name, owner, tablespace_name, status from dba_rollback_segs;SEGMENT_NAME OWNER TABLESPACE_NAME STATUS--------------------...
---检查undo show parameter undo_ ---检查undo rollback segment 使用情况 select name, rssize, extents, latch, xacts, writes, gets, waits from v$rollstat a, v$rollname b where a.usn = b.usn ...
本章没有讲回滚段如何在事务中使用,重点是回滚段的管理。 1.事务基本信息 回滚段,和表段、索引段一样,就是一个“段”空间。用来保存前映像相关数据。不同之处是:由Oracle自行管理。Oracle会在需要时创建回滚...
相信很多人都见过这样的错误,通常是一个程序运行了很久很久,突然报一个快照过...这要牵涉到Oracle独特的多版本特性,它会通过回滚段来保证读数据的一致性:Oracle读取的数据,总是某一个时间点的表数据,无论后面...